Franca Rasi‐Caldogno is a scholar working on Plant Science, Molecular Biology and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Franca Rasi‐Caldogno has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 32 papers in Plant Science, 19 papers in Molecular Biology and 3 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Franca Rasi‐Caldogno’s work include Plant Stress Responses and Tolerance (22 papers),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(17 papers) and Legume Nitrogen Fixing Symbiosis (14 papers). Franca Rasi‐Caldogno is often cited by papers focused on Plant Stress Responses and Tolerance (22 papers),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(17 papers) and Legume Nitrogen Fixing Symbiosis (14 papers). Franca Rasi‐Caldogno collaborates with scholars based in Italy. Franca Rasi‐Caldogno's co-authors include Maria Ida De Michelis, Maria Chiara Pugliarello, C. Olivari, Roberta Colombo, P. Lado, E. Marrè, Raffaella Cerana, Maria Cristina Bonza, Francesco Macrı̀ and Angelo Vianello and has published in prestigious journals such as PLANT PHYSIOLOGY,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ications and FEBS Letters.
